Emblem, emblem and symbology of Matyla

Although not all surnames have an emblem, coat of arms or symbology, it is always interesting to investigate the symbology of the Matyla surname. To understand this it is necessary to know that the association of an emblem with the Matyla surname generally has its origins in the history and tradition of nobility, chivalry or prominent families in a society. The practice of granting and using emblems began in Europe during the Middle Ages, primarily as a form of identification in battle, but also as a symbol of status, power and legacy.

Keys to understand the heraldry availability of the surname Matyla

Exclusivity and privilege of the heraldry, blazon and coat of arms of Matyla

Traditionally, the coat of arms is awarded to a particular individual with the surname Matyla, without encompassing all those who bear the surname Matyla. The right to use a specific coat of arms is transmitted according to the laws and customs of heraldry, which means that not all individuals with the surname Matyla have the heraldic right to use the coat of arms associated with their ancestors.< /p>

Relationship of the heraldic shield with the surname Matyla

The connection between the heraldic shield and Matyla is deep and enigmatic. Initially, coats of arms were awarded to individuals, not entire families, and were related to the individual who had received them for their achievements, victories in battle or social position. Over time, the Matyla coat of arms became hereditary, becoming a distinctive emblem of the family lineage, thus establishing a close relationship with the Matyla surname.

Key points about the connection between the coat of arms and the family name Matyla

Legacy: Although the coat of arms could be associated with Matyla, it is relevant to remember that they were initially granted to individuals. This implies that not all individuals with the family name Matyla have heraldic legitimacy over the crest linked to Matyla, particularly if they cannot demonstrate a direct lineage to the original owner of the crest. In the same way, it is possible to find different shields for the family name Matyla, since they could have been granted to people of different lineages but with the family name Matyla.

Variations: Within a family that bears the surname Matyla, it is common to find different versions of the heraldic blazon that serve to distinguish between the different family branches, lineages, or noble titles that have been awarded over the years.

Rules and control: Heraldry is a field that has regulations in several countries, where standards are established for the registration and appropriate use of coats of arms. These rules are essential to guarantee the authenticity and correct transmission of the family legacy associated with the surname Matyla. The heraldic authorities are responsible for supervising the granting and registration process, offering research services for those interested in formalizing the adoption of the heraldic shield of Matyla.
